Abstract
The invention discloses a flame-retardant wear-resistant nylon fabric. The flame-retardant wear-resistant nylon fabric comprises a base fabric layer and at least one coating layer, wherein the base fabric layer is woven by interweaving warps and wefts; fibers of the warps and the wefts comprise the following components in parts by weight: 70-90 parts of polycaprolactam fibers, 8-29 parts of glass fibers and 1-2 parts of a fire retardant I; each coating layer comprises the following components in parts by weight: 60-80 parts of modified organic silicon resin, 2-5 parts of a fire retardant II, 3-5 parts of titanium dioxide powder, 4-9 parts of alumina silicate fibers, 1-3 parts of a cross-linking agent and 10-15 parts of a solvent. According to the flame-retardant wear-resistant nylon fabric, the base fabric layer has a certain flame-retardant performance; after the flame-retardant wear-resistant nylon fabric is subjected to coating treatment, the flame-retardant performance of the whole fabric can be well improved; meanwhile, the fabric has a certain comfortableness and wear-resistant performance; the flame-retardant wear-resistant nylon fabric is applicable to various fields.

Background technology
Nylon facing material is conventional weaving face fabric, and structure and the character of nylon fiber approach natural silk, have good ABRASION RESISTANCE and intensity, and material is lighter, is suitable as very much daily life and outwork fabric.But along with people are to the polyfunctional requirement of fabric and adapt to various complex environments, the fire resistance of fabric obtains people and pays close attention to.
Existing inflaming retarding fabric, take acrylic fibers as main, makes flame-retardant acrylic fibre by adding fire-retardant different fire-retardant functional group.The acrylic fabric of making thus, lacks certain comfort level and ABRASION RESISTANCE, and fire resistance is lower, causes applicable field limited, can not meet people's demand.
Summary of the invention
Goal of the invention: for above-mentioned deficiency, the object of the invention is to provide a kind of nylon facing material of fire-retardant and good abrasion resistance.
Technical scheme of the present invention: a kind of flame-proof abrasion-resistant nylon facing material, comprise base cloth layer and one deck coating at least, wherein:
Base cloth layer is interweaved with weaving by warp and parallel and forms, and the fiber of its middle longitude and parallel is made up of the component of following mass fraction: capron(e) 70-90 part, glass fibre 8-29 part and fire retardant I 1-2 part;
Coating is made up of the component of following mass fraction: modified organic silicone resin 60-80 part, fire retardant II 2-5 part, titanium dioxide 3-5 part, alumina silicate fibre 4-9 part, crosslinking agent 1-3 part and solvent 10-15 part.
As preferably, fire retardant I is TDE.
As preferably, fire retardant II is APP or Firebrake ZB.
As preferably, crosslinking agent is isocyanates crosslinking agent.
As preferably, solvent is toluene or dimethylbenzene.
Beneficial effect: the flame-proof abrasion-resistant nylon facing material that technical solution of the present invention provides, not only base cloth layer has certain fire resistance, and after coating is processed, the fire resistance of whole fabric is better promoted, still there is certain comfortableness and anti-wear performance, applicable to multiple fields simultaneously.

Below by specific experiment, further illustrate the excellent effect that the present invention reaches.
The nylon cloth coating fabric that the above-mentioned specific embodiment is made is made model, and getting common acrylic fibers inflaming retarding fabric is control group, tests according to the ABRASION RESISTANCE of weaving face fabric and fire resistance, and result is as follows:
ABRASION RESISTANCE (returning): embodiment 1 is that 976, embodiment 2 is that 988, embodiment 3 is 982, and control group is that 523, embodiment 1-3 is all better than control group;
Fire resistance: embodiment 1-3 is that A level is not fired, and control group is B level, and embodiment 1-3 is all better than control group.
Hence one can see that, and flame-proof abrasion-resistant nylon facing material provided by the invention has good anti-wear performance and fire resistance.
